As Business Development Manager – West London, you will be responsible for developing, managing and growing our On‑Trade presence across a defined territory through strong execution, trusted relationships and impactful brand building.

The role is field‑based, with at least 80% of time spent in trade, managing a call file across Independent Free Trade, Multiple Site Operators and a small number of specialist retail customers. You will be expected to live within commutable distance of your customer base.

The primary brand focus is The Dalmore, supported by Jura and Fettercairn, ensuring our brands are present, visible and activated in the right outlets, for the right consumers and occasions.

A key measure of success in this role is the ability to drive standout The Dalmore visibility, with a strong focus on delivering high‑quality 3‑SKU Dalmore billboards across the territory through energy, persistence and excellent customer partnerships.

Responsibilities:
  • Driving sustainable distribution growth.
  • Creating impactful, premium brand presence in outlet.
  • Building strong customer and partner relationships.
  • Delivering visible, memorable activations with commercial outcomes.
  • Acting as an authentic and knowledgeable ambassador for our brands.
  • Manage a defined call file of approximately 150 On‑Trade outlets across West London.
  • Plan and execute effective journey plans, typically 4 weeks in advance.
  • Use reporting tools and insight to prioritise opportunities, with a clear focus on premium visibility wins.
  • Drive distribution of The Dalmore as the priority brand, supported by Jura and Fettercairn.
  • Proactively deliver 3‑SKU Dalmore billboard displays across the territory, identifying the right outlets, occasions and partners to maximise impact.
  • Act as a brand ambassador through engaging tastings, education and training where appropriate.
  • Manage activation activity within agreed budgets, ensuring efficient use of resources and maximum brand impact.
